
Omicof D Syrup
Marketer
Eskos Pharma
Salt Composition
Chlorpheniramine Maleate (2mg) + Dextromethorphan Hydrobromide (10mg)
Overview Omicof D Syrup
Dry cough relief is offered by the dual-action formulation in Omicof D Syrup. This syrup temporarily alleviates cough symptoms stemming from throat inflammation, sneezing, and rhinorrhea. Its mechanism involves suppressing the brain's cough reflex and counteracting histamine's effects. Omicof D Syrup is administered as directed by a physician, with or without food, for the prescribed duration and dosage. Dosage is tailored to individual needs and response. Complete the prescribed course; premature cessation may lead to symptom recurrence and potential worsening of the condition. Disclose all other medications to your doctor, as interactions are possible. Common, usually transient side effects include drowsiness, lethargy, and vertigo. Report any concerning side effects immediately. Avoid driving or tasks requiring alertness if drowsiness or dizziness occur. Alcohol consumption should be avoided due to potential exacerbation of dizziness. Adequate hydration is recommended. Individuals with liver conditions or pregnant/breastfeeding women should consult their physician prior to use to ensure appropriate dosage.

How Omicof D Syrup works:
Omicof D Syrup combines Chlorpheniramine Maleate and Dextromethorphan Hydrobromide to effectively alleviate dry coughs. The antihistamine, Chlorpheniramine Maleate, counteracts allergy-related coughing by inhibiting histamine's action. Meanwhile, Dextromethorphan Hydrobromide, a central nervous system depressant, suppresses the cough reflex by dampening brain activity in the cough center.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CAUTION
Exercise caution when combining Omicof D Syrup and alcohol. Seek medical advice.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Omicof D Syrup during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to a developing fetus. A physician will assess the potential benefits against possible risks prior to any prescription. Physician consultation is recommended.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Breastfeeding mothers can likely use Omicof D Syrup safely. Available data from human studies indicate minimal ris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ving ability may be impaired by side effects associated with Omicof D Syrup.
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Omicof D Syrup in individuals with kidney impairment is likely safe. Existing evidence indicates dose modification may be unnecessary, however, medical advice is recommended.
LiverUNSAFE
Patients with liver conditions should likely avoid Omicof D Syrup due to potential safety concerns. Physician consultation is recommended.
What if you forget to take Omicof D Syrup :
Should you forget a dose of Omicof D Syrup, administer it at your earliest convenience.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
